Death of Robert Legge

Posted on

I extend my sincere sympathy and condolences to the wife and family of former Fingal Councillor and Break O’Day Mayor, Robert Legge AM.
Before entering local government, Robert farmed in the Fingal Valley, where his family roots date back to 1826.
Mr Legge served in local government for nearly 50 years, serving as Mayor of Break O’Day for 13 years until his retirement in 2011.
He also served on the Board of the Australian Local Government Association and was a member of the Local Government Association of Tasmania
Robert was known for his hard work and commitment to building a safer and better community. His passion was to motivate others to look to the future and think about tomorrow.
Robert was awarded an Order of Australia Medal in 2017 for significant service to the community through roles at the state, national and international level with the Red Cross.
He leaves behind his wife Jean, four children, grandchildren and great-grandchildren.

Guy Barnett, Liberal Member for Lyons
